From 0ba3278146ee39a06159a520664e0617da113789 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Hans Dedecker Date: Tue, 12 Sep 2017 11:03:37 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] dhcpv4: rework assignment lookup When receiving a DHCPv4 message use find_assignment_by_hwaddr to find an assignment as only one entry can be present in the assignment table for a given mac address. While at it pass requested address by the client as an uint32_t type to clean up the code.
